This new store is absolutely fabulous! I am so glad I saw the one review on here and another on Tripadvisor when I was looking for a place to buy ribs to take up to a friend’s lake place. I bought Swank’s ribs, and a rub from Yah Butz, both local places, one from St. Croix Falls, the other from Siren. They have marinades, rubs, lots of local meats and not so local frozen seafoods. Then on one side of the building is a wonderful custard stand with sandwiches. I had just a taste of custard which was eggy and rich and wonderful and a very good cup of coffee as well! if you are looking to shop Local, go here!

I stopped in to grab a bite to eat, and was pleasantly surprised! Bright, clean and welcoming, it’s really a one stop shop. I enjoyed a Chicago dog and some chocolate custard for dessert. Both were worth a trip back. After lunch, I browsed around the myriad of local products they offer along with many hard to find items like frog legs, alligator, sashimi grade tuna and gorgeous king crab legs. I left with some breakfast sausages and a pint of custard, but I’ll be back!
